Industrial Disperser Mixers: A Comprehensive Guide

Industrial blending devices are critical components in many manufacturing industries, designed to efficiently distribute particles within a fluid. These specialized systems go beyond conventional mixing, offering complex capabilities for achieving consistent suspensions. From coatings and inks to polymers, the proper selection and use of a disperser machine is essential for item standard. This guide will examine the various sorts available, their techniques of working, and aspects for ideal performance. Troubleshooting Common Issues with Industrial Disperser Mixers Addressing frequent problems with heavy-duty disperser blenders requires a methodical method . Frequently , the main cause of operational degradation lies in easily overlooked elements. Here's a brief examination at several typical challenges . Bearing failure : Hear for unusual vibrations and check journal heat . Lubrication is essential . Impeller damage : See for evidence of erosion , like fracturing . Ensure adequate rotor choice for the material being handled . Seal leaks : Review gaskets for damage . Replace worn seals immediately. Motor overload : Observe drive amperage . Correct any electrical imbalances . Regular upkeep and careful monitoring are vital to avoiding significant shutdowns.
